Originally Posted by Reverant (Post 888998)
Torkel, you need to recalibrate the MS AFR table. Tools -> Calibrate AFR and select the calibration that matches, hit Burn and start the car. The AFR gauge should now follow the DB gauge. You also need to recalibrathe CLT and IAT sensors.
